#200ed1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#200ed1 is composed of 12.5% red, 5.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 43.7%. #200ed1 color hex could be obtained by blending #401cff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#200ed1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#200ed1 has RGB values of R:32, G:14,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2100945.

Hex triplet 200ed1 #200ed1
RGB Decimal 32, 14, 209 rgb(32,14,209)
RGB Percent 12.5, 5.5, 82 rgb(12.5%,5.5%,82%)
CMYK 85, 93, 0, 18
HSL 245.5°, 87.4, 43.7 hsl(245.5,87.4%,43.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 245.5°, 93.3, 82
Web Safe 3300cc #3300cc
CIE-LAB 27.363, 65.716, -89.822
XYZ 12.259, 5.224, 60.68
xyY 0.157, 0.067, 5.224
CIE-LCH 27.363, 111.295, 306.19
CIE-LUV 27.363, -6.401, -105.26
Hunter-Lab 22.856, 55.745, -141.413
Binary 00100000, 00001110, 11010001

Shades and Tints of #200ed1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010007 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#200ed1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6c73 is the less saturated color, while #1905da is the most saturated one.
